About Community Centers
Definition of Community Centers and their importance in society
Community Centers are facilities that serve as gathering places for individuals, families, and communities to participate in diverse programs and activities. Community Centers are essential to society because they provide a safe place for people to connect, share experiences, reduce social isolation, and promote a sense of belonging. They help to build social capital by creating opportunities for people to work together towards common goals and fostering relationships across diverse backgrounds.Types of services and programs offered by Community Centers
Community Centers offer a broad range of services and programs to meet the needs of their local communities. These may include educational programs such as literacy classes and after-school programs, recreational activities such as sports teams and dance classes, social events such as potlucks and movie nights, and health and wellness programs such as exercise classes and health screenings. They may also offer support services such as counseling, job training, and legal advice.Benefits of using Community Centers for individuals and communities
There are numerous benefits to using Community Centers. For individuals, Community Centers provide opportunities for personal growth, social interaction, and skill-building. They can also help to improve physical and mental health and reduce stress. For communities, Community Centers can serve as hubs for civic engagement, a place to address community issues and organize community projects. They can also help to build social cohesion, promote cross-cultural understanding, and improve the overall quality of life in the community.Funding sources and partnerships for Community Centers
Community Centers may receive funding from a range of sources, including government grants, private donations, and corporate sponsorship. They may also partner with local businesses, schools, and non-profit organizations to provide additional resources and support. Volunteers are often an essential part of Community Centers, providing invaluable time and expertise to help run programs and events.Examples of successful Community Centers and their impact on local communities
Successful Community Centers can have a significant impact on local communities. For example, the Upper Norwood Library Hub in South London provides a range of services and activities, from a library and co-working space to a community café and children’s activities. The Hub has helped to improve community cohesion and provided much-needed services to local residents, including a space for community groups to meet and organize events.Challenges faced by Community Centers and how they are addressed
Community Centers face many challenges, including budget constraints, staffing and volunteer recruitment and retention, and meeting the diverse needs and interests of their communities. To address these challenges, Community Centers may seek out partnerships with other organizations and businesses, seek out alternative funding sources, and actively engage with the community to understand their needs and interests better.How to get involved with or support Community Centers in your area
There are many ways to get involved with or support Community Centers in your area. You can volunteer your time and skills to assist with programs and events or donate money or resources to support the Center's activities. You can also attend events and programs at the Center, help to spread the word about their activities, and encourage others to get involved and support the Center.Future developments and innovations in Community Center services and programs
As the needs of communities evolve, Community Centers must also adapt and develop new services and programs to meet those needs. Innovative new programs may include coding and digital literacy courses, sustainable living initiatives, and intergenerational activities that promote stronger connections between different age groups. Technology can also play a significant role in the future of Community Centers, with online platforms providing opportunities for virtual communities to connect and engage with one another.
